The Dálnice 2 (D2) highway was built as a combination of the second largest Czech city of Brno with the Slovak capital Bratislava. Combined with the D1 motorway, the two largest cities in the former Czechoslovakia were linked: Prague and Bratislava. The individual sections in the direction of Slovakia were opened in 1978 and 1980. Today, the highway leading to the Slovakian border, where Lanzhot south of the border crossing Břeclav / Brodské over the March leads to the Slovak D 2.

On the route of the D2 motorway interchange is planned for the expressway R55 at Břeclav.
